The Occupational Safety and Health Administration investigated the death of a man found dead inside an insulation factory.

A janitor found the 57-year-old man inside the Newark Owens Corning Plant, located at 400 Case St., on Sunday.

The man, whose identity was not immediately released, responded to the plant with a coworker on Saturday to check on a sprinkler alarm.

A representative of the Licking County Coroner's Office said that they would wait for word from OSHA before determining a cause of death.

The circumstances surrounding the man's death were not immediately determined. It is standard operating procedure for OSHA to investigate workplace deaths.
